Summary

Parliament approved the Mines and Minerals Amendment Bill, 2026, on Thursday. This legislation empowers the central government to regulate state taxes on mineral rights. Excessive fiscal burdens were cited as a reason for the new restrictions. The move follows a Supreme Court verdict allowing states to levy additional mining taxes. A uniform fiscal framework will guide future mining tax impositions across the nation.
